Funding for this research was provided by:
National Natural Science Foundation of China (51975199)
State Key Laboratory of Advanced Design and Manufacturing for Vehicle Body (71865010)
Article History
Received: 14 July 2020
Accepted: 18 May 2021
First Online: 4 June 2021
Declarations
:
: The authors declare that they have no competing interests.